15 ejemplos populares de plataforma como servicio (PaaS)

Actualizado: 15 de marzo de 2021 / Artículo de: Timothy Shim

¿Qué es PaaS?

PaaS permite a los desarrolladores crear sus propias aplicaciones sin tener que mantener la infraestructura. (fuente).

La plataforma como servicio (PaaS) se ajusta al perfil de las empresas modernas: de ritmo rápido y muy ágil. Ofrece a las empresas la capacidad de crear rápidamente soluciones personalizadas con la ayuda de herramientas avanzadas. Un beneficio importante radica en la teoría de evitar la reinvención de la rueda.

En lugar de codificar todo desde cero, los proveedores de PaaS a menudo tienen bloques prediseñados que los desarrolladores pueden conectar y usar para crear mejores aplicaciones rápidamente.

La escalabilidad de la nube también significa que no hay mucha necesidad de autoaprovisionamiento, y todo esto a precios más bajos.

Lea también

1. SAP Cloud

SAP Cloud - ejemplo de paas

SAP es una empresa realmente grande, tanto que sus ofertas abarcan múltiples modelos de servicio. Entre ellos se encuentra su Cloud PaaS, que es una plataforma empresarial abierta. Fue diseñado para ayudar a los desarrolladores a crear aplicaciones con mayor facilidad, ofreciendo amplitud y profundidad de servicio.

La plataforma también abre la posibilidad de integrar aplicaciones en la nube y en las instalaciones y proporciona muchos servicios de apoyo. Parte de esto se debe al inmenso ecosistema de socios de SAP, que ofrece una impresionante biblioteca de más de 1,300 aplicaciones creadas en la misma plataforma.

2. Microsoft Azure

Microsoft Azure - example of PaaS

Microsoft Azure es un entorno de implementación y desarrollo que utiliza el concepto PaaS. Debido a su naturaleza, Azure es capaz de soportar todo el ciclo de vida del desarrollo de aplicaciones web, desde la compilación hasta la implementación y posteriormente.

Azure también admite una amplia gama de herramientas, lenguajes y marcos. Los desarrolladores que lo utilicen pueden acceder a más de cien servicios asociados a un servicio de computación en la nube de Microsoft. Debido al gran tamaño de Azure, abarca los tres modelos de nube: SaaS, PaaS e IaaS.

3. Heroku

Heroku belongs to Salesforce and is PaaS based.

Heroku ahora pertenece a Salesforce y es un ejemplo de PaaS basado en el concepto de contenedor administrado. Como ocurre con muchos entornos PaaS, es muy autónomo e integra servicios de datos, así como un ecosistema completo propio.

Debido a que se centra en las aplicaciones, Heroku se ha ganado la reputación de ser una solución menos empresarial. En cambio, ha ganado seguidores entre la multitud de aficionados y desarrolladores de producción. También ayuda que Heroku sea bastante fácil de usar, lo que le permite ofrecer una experiencia más ágil. 

Para aquellos interesados ​​en desarrollar Heroku, he visto aplicaciones creadas en esta plataforma que han logrado precios respetables. Por ejemplo, El regular, construido para vender alimentos y bebidas, se cotiza en Flippa por alrededor de $ 25,000.

4. AWS Lambda

AWS Lambda is a part of Amazon cloud

AWS Lambda, que forma parte de Amazon Cloud, está realmente diseñado para funcionar como parte del todo. Básicamente, está destinado a respaldar la gestión eficiente de los recursos de AWS. Esto significa que los usuarios pueden ejecutar código sin necesidad de aprovisionar recursos o administrar el servidor.

La naturaleza de Lambda lo hace bueno para cualquier tipo de desarrollo: el entorno es compatible con múltiples códigos, ya que están aprovisionados. Los usuarios lo han alabado por su arquitectura sin servidor y la capacidad de manejar fácilmente la arquitectura de microservicio.

5. Google App Engine

5. Google App Engine: ejemplo de PaaS

Google ofrece su App Engine como parte del ecosistema de Google Cloud. Está destinado a ser una PaaS sin servidor altamente escalable que se utiliza para una implementación rápida. Google, siendo el gigante que es, puede proporcionar servidores de alta capacidad capaces de hacer frente a casi cualquier volumen de consultas.

Sin embargo, los desarrolladores han planteado algunos problemas sobre el servicio. Estos incluyen una ligera falta de soporte en algunos entornos de lenguaje, escasez de herramientas de desarrollo, incapacidad para conectar y reproducir algunas aplicaciones, además de un bloqueo en Google como proveedor.

6. Dokku

Dokku - ejemplo de PaaS

Dokku, que se alaba a sí mismo como la “implementación de PaaS más pequeña que jamás haya visto”, es un ejemplo de PaaS que no es tan capaz como los grandes actores como AWS. Sin embargo, lo que le falta en profundidad lo compensa en costo: Dokku es de código abierto y completamente gratuito. 

Basado en la tecnología de contenedores de Docker, este minuto PaaS esencialmente le permite implementar en cualquier infraestructura. La gran ventaja de esto es que hay una posibilidad mucho menor de bloqueo del proveedor, por lo que podrá llevar su modelo de negocio en la dirección que desee.

7. Apprenda Cloud Platform

Apprenda Cloud Platform

Apprenda se considera más hacia la escala empresarial de la industria de desarrollo e implementación de aplicaciones en la nube. Su plataforma se basa en Kubernetes y aprovecha las tecnologías de código abierto. Una de sus características definitorias es la capacidad de ayudar a los usuarios a trasladar aplicaciones dot net heredadas a un entorno PaaS.

Desafortunadamente, han surgido problemas entre los usuarios de Apprenda que oscurecen ligeramente sus capacidades. Por ejemplo, algunos usuarios han informado de entornos que no están bien optimizados en cuanto a la eficiencia del uso de la memoria.

8. Pivotal Cloud Foundry

Pivotal Cloud Foundry (PCF) es la distribución de código abierto de la plataforma Cloud Foundry. Está ligeramente mejorado para este propósito, lo que lo hace un poco más fácil de usar e incluye más funciones. PCF se puede implementar en plataformas IaaS como vSphere.

Como muchas implementaciones de PaaS, se puede utilizar para una implementación y mantenimiento rápidos de aplicaciones. También es capaz de optimizar las actualizaciones de aplicaciones. Una gran parte de su atractivo radica en la automatización y la facilidad de uso en casi cualquier base de la nube.

9. Salesforce Lightning

Lightning es lo que Salesforce considera la próxima generación de su plataforma. Es independiente de Salesforce Classic (que es SaaS) y será el objetivo de todos los desarrollos futuros de Salesforce en el futuro.

Lightning ofrece una interfaz de usuario muy mejorada y tiene mejoras que impulsarán la experiencia tanto de los usuarios comerciales como del equipo de TI. Una parte importante de la característica de desarrollo rápido es la inclusión de componentes básicos reutilizables y un nuevo sistema de entrega.

10. IBM Cloud Foundry

IBM Cloud Foundry es una plataforma PaaS basada

Dado que la mayoría de los principales proveedores de TI tienen sus propias plataformas PaaS, no sorprende que IBM también tenga su propia versión. Sorprendentemente, IBM Cloud optó por una versión de código abierto de su PaaS que ha demostrado ser potente y ágil.

A pesar de eso, no ha podido resistirse a publicitar la plataforma como una forma para que las empresas resuelvan problemas complejos, que es más una exageración de marketing que una realidad. Aún así, se ha probado con una amplia variedad de aplicaciones y, a pesar de un ligero rendimiento inferior al de las grandes implementaciones, todavía se está ampliando.

11. Red Hat OpenShift

OpenShift es la plataforma de computación en la nube como servicio (PaaS) de Red Hat

OpenShift es de alguna manera similar a Cloudways y ofrece a los usuarios una forma más sencilla de crear e implementar aplicaciones. También tiene un amplio soporte de API para que no se limite solo a lo que la plataforma tiene para ofrecer.

Viniendo de Red Hat, OpenShift también es conocido por ser increíblemente seguro. Hay varias salvaguardas integradas en el entorno que intervendrán si los usuarios intentan realizar acciones inesperadas (como intentar ejecutar contenedores con permisos incorrectos).

12. Oracle Cloud Platform

Oracle Cloud Platform es la plataforma como servicio (PaaS) de Oracle

Oracle es otro de los grandes de la industria que tiene un dedo en todos los aspectos de la nube. Su oferta de PaaS es una de sus cuatro líneas de productos pilares de la nube. Fue diseñado para funcionar principalmente con aplicaciones Oracle SaaS, pero también funciona con otras.

Habiendo dicho eso, ha recibido críticas un tanto mixtas hasta la fecha, y los usuarios han descubierto que parece haber un equilibrio de pros y contras según para qué lo usan. Entre las cuestiones que se plantean a un nivel más genérico se encuentran las deficiencias del panel de control, la complejidad y el tiempo necesario para, por ejemplo, el aprovisionamiento.

13. Zoho Creator

En comparación con muchas plataformas PaaS a escala empresarial, Zoho Creator es una oferta increíblemente simple de estilo de bloque de construcción. Básicamente, funciona como un creador de aplicaciones turbo que permite a los usuarios simplemente arrastrar y soltar contenedores reutilizables para crear funcionalidad. También es capaz de construir para múltiples objetivos de implementación.

El bajo costo de entrada lo convierte en una opción sólida para las organizaciones más pequeñas que buscan construir y entregar. Alternativamente, las empresas más grandes también pueden tomarlo como un trampolín hacia la digitalización. Los usuarios han comentado que usarlo puede ser tan simple como aprender de un video de Youtube.

14. Wasabi

Es posible que Wasabi no tenga el tamaño de Google, Amazon u Oracle, pero es uno de los proveedores independientes de PaaS más grandes del mercado. Su impresionante precio los ha hecho populares para una variedad mucho más amplia de casos de uso, como Cloud Storage

Tiene una interfaz simple y también es fácil de usar y configurar. Esto lo convierte en una buena opción tanto para uso personal como para pequeñas y medianas empresas. La conveniencia en estas situaciones compensa a quienes tienen un acceso más limitado a equipos de soporte técnico sólidos.

15. Cloudways

Cloudways es quizás único en esta lista porque está extremadamente arraigado en el industria de alojamiento web. Aunque es como muchas otras plataformas PaaS y ofrece a los usuarios una alta capacidad de configuración para una implementación rápida, muchos lo han utilizado para crear servidores virtuales personalizados para el alojamiento.

Parte de la razón es su provisión de alojamiento administrado, que combina el poder de Cloud PaaS sin la parte demasiado técnica de la administración del entorno. Los modelos de precios también son tan transparentes como muchos otros.

Tú también puedes aprenda más sobre Cloudways en la revisión de Jerry.

Acerca de Timothy Shim

Timothy Shim es escritor, editor y experto en tecnología. Comenzando su carrera en el campo de la tecnología de la información, rápidamente encontró su camino en la impresión y desde entonces ha trabajado con títulos de medios internacionales, regionales y nacionales, incluidos ComputerWorld, PC.com, Business Today y The Asian Banker. Su experiencia se encuentra en el campo de la tecnología tanto desde el punto de vista del consumidor como desde el de la empresa.